We said

Thank you for your request.

1. Is a catering restaurant or café provided on the premises?

Yes, at 2 of our sites.

2. What are the addresses of the buildings in which the restaurants or cafés are located?

Government Buildings Cardiff Road Newport South Wales NP10 8XG

Segensworth Road Titchfield Fareham Hampshire PO15 5RR

3. Who is the current catering incumbent of the catering contract?

Baxterstorey.

4. What is the catering value? (Or is it nil subsidy?) Are the catering facilities shared with other departments?

Catering is approx. £1.7m per annum and at nil subsidy. Other government departments share the facilities at both sites.

5. When is the catering service contract due for re-tender?

The catering contract is part of the soft FM contract and will be retendered as part of that contract. Currently, we have no plans to disaggregate that contract.

6. How will it be re-tendered?

As part of the soft FM Contract via competition.

7. Is the contract part of a PFI?

No.

8. Is it part of an FM contract? (and if so, what services are also included in the contract?) Who provides the other soft FM services?

Yes, it is part of a FM contract with Vinci Construction UK Ltd and services include:

  • Maintenance services

  • Horticultural services

  • Statutory obligations

  • Catering services

  • Cleaning services

  • Workplace FM services

  • Reception services

  • Security services

  • Waste services

  • Miscellaneous FM services

  • Computer-aided facilities management (CAFM)

  • Helpdesk services

  • Management of billable works

10. When will the tender notice be issued?

Over the next few months we will review the options to inform the decision of whether we wish to take advantage of the 2-year extension in the contract to 30 September 2023 or to maintain the end date of 30 September 2021.

13. Is it on the CCS framework?

The current contract was sourced via the CCS Framework but no decision on the future route has been made.

14. Who in the department is responsible for the management of the contract?

Jeremy Edwards is the current Contract Manager.

15. How many people are there on-site per day?

At our Newport Site, there is on average 3000 to 3500 per day on site; at our Titchfield site, this number is around 1000 to 1200.
